MGM released a feature film titled House of Dark Shadows in 1970. By early 1971, though, ABC was trying to cut costs in the face of harsh new economic realities including a national economic recession, a sharp dip in advertising revenue following the discontinuance of cigarette commercials, and a record-high number of competing soap operaswhich were more expensive to produce than game or talk showson the networks' daytime schedules. Try our quiz and enter to win $500!Click below to check the trivia question Dark Shadows aired weekdays on the ABC television network from June 27, 1966, to April 2, 1971. There are probably 20 or more clubs active on Facebook right now. The series chronicled the lives, romances, trials, and tribulations of the wealthy and absolutely psychotic Collins family who lived in Collinsport, Maine where a number of spooky, supernatural occurrences took place.The show became especially popular after the vampire character Barnabas Collins was introduced ten months into its run.
